CMS Made Simple News Feed http://ubdc.net Current News entries The UBDC-TetraPak agreement Wed, 10 Oct 2007 09:56:57 GMT English Meetings with TetraPak in Kyiv, July 18th and August 10th, 2007 It was determent that the UBDC-Tetra Pak contract will be continued for another year. And a joint TetraPak–Idea Lab/UBDC Education project was proposed. This will start in September-October, 2007 and channel the Idea Competitions in the area of environment. One week prior to our Idea Competitions we are to present a film in Environmental protection by Albert Gor. The purpose is to encourage students to participate in Idea Competitions. The winners of these competitions will also have the opportunity to do summer internship with a TetraPak company.  It was determent that the UBDC-Tetra Pak contract will be continued for another year. Financial support from the City of Lviv Mon, 1 Oct 2007 09:23:53 GMT English The City for Lviv contributes financial support for the Idea Lab operations The City for Lviv contributes financial support for the Idea Lab operations (about 20 000 Hrn), and prizes for our Idea competition winners if these ideas are related to the city’s development. The Mayor noted that he is especially interested in the Idea generation process and encourage such a platform for communication between the city and the university. Creativity Course, fall 2007 Sat, 1 Sep 2007 09:53:12 GMT English A course will be given in autumn 2007 at the Ivan Franko National University of Lviv (IFU), Department of Applied Mathematics & Informatics.  The course is also available for students from other faculties at IFU and will be headed by Mälardalen University (MDH), and be linked to and support the joint project between IFU and MDH in building a University Business Development Centre (UBDC) at IFU. Teachers include faculty at the Department of Innovation, Design & Product Development at MDH as well as teachers from IFU and regional trade and industry.   The course includes teacher driven lectures, exercises, seminars in total 8 days at the following dates: Oct 10-12 (15.30-19.30) Nov 21-23 (15.30-19.30) Dec 4-5 (15.30.19.30)Student driven exercises/projects will be carried out independently by the student teams running throughout the whole course with strong links to the IUF Idea Competition.This course is on advanced level (in accordance with the European Union “Bologna system”) and is available for three and four year students and master students. The course will have maximum 25 participants. The UBDC Project has established a partnership with Lithuanian organizations Thu, 29 Jun 2006 11:16:26 GMT English The UBDC Project is proud to announce a partnership with leading Lithuanian academic and incubation institutions. The partners are; The Lithuanian ministry of Education, The Kaunas University of Technology, the Kaunas University of Technology Regional Business Incubator and Alytus college. The partnership has been formed within the context of the UBDC Project, and consists of; student exchanges - Lithuanian students from the above academic institutions will participate in the UBDC Project training and knowledge transfer activities towards UkraineAdvisory board - the Lithuanian partners will have representatives in the UBDC Project Advisory BoardAcademic curriuculum on entrepreneurship and innovation - Mälardalen University, Kaunas University of Technology and Alytus College will collaborate in the knowledge transfer of academic curriuculums to Ukraine.  The partners are; The Lithuanian ministry of Education, The Kaunas University of Technology, the Kaunas University of Technology Regional Business Incubator and Alytus college. UBDC Project Meeting in Kyiv Follow-up Mon, 27 Mar 2006 15:36:15 GMT English The UBDC project team met in Kyiv, at the KPI/IUF University, during March 9th-March 13th. During these four days, the local KPI/IUF team also organized a large event for KPI/IUF students. The event contained a presentation of the UBDC project´s values to students, and the team also had the participants conduct a survey on entrepreneurship. In addition, an inspirational lecture was also held by the Ukrainian entrepreneur; Valeria Kirpichnikova. Ms. Kirpichnikova held a very appreciated and inspiring presentation, in which she shared her views on the importance of entrepreneurship for Ukraine, and the key areas to think about when starting up a company in Ukraine.
